Subject: [PATCH V4 3/4] blk-mq: add tagset quiesce interface
Date: Wed, 9 Sep 2020 18:41:15 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200909104116.1674592-4-ming.lei@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200909104116.1674592-1-ming.lei@redhat.com>
drivers that have shared tagsets may need to quiesce potentially a lot
of request queues that all share a single tagset (e.g. nvme). Add an interface
to quiesce all the queues on a given tagset. This interface is useful because
it can speedup the quiesce by doing it in parallel.
For tagsets that have BLK_MQ_F_BLOCKING set, we kill request queue's dispatch
percpu-refcount such that all of them wait for the counter becoming zero. For
tagsets that don't have BLK_MQ_F_BLOCKING set, we simply call a single
synchronize_rcu as this is sufficient.

+void blk_mq_quiesce_tagset(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set)
+{
+ struct request_queue *q;
+
+ mutex_lock(&set->tag_list_lock);
+ list_for_each_entry(q, &set->tag_list, tag_set_list)
+ __blk_mq_quiesce_queue(q, false);
+
+ /* wait until all queues' quiesce is done */
+ if (set->flags & BLK_MQ_F_BLOCKING) {
+ list_for_each_entry(q, &set->tag_list, tag_set_list)
+ wait_event(q->mq_quiesce_wq,
+ percpu_ref_is_zero(&q->dispatch_counter));
+ } else {
+ synchronize_rcu();
+ }
+ mutex_unlock(&set->tag_list_lock);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(blk_mq_quiesce_tagset);
+
+void blk_mq_unquiesce_tagset(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set)
+{
+ struct request_queue *q;
+
+ mutex_lock(&set->tag_list_lock);
+ list_for_each_entry(q, &set->tag_list, tag_set_list)
+ blk_mq_unquiesce_queue(q);
+ mutex_unlock(&set->tag_list_lock);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(blk_mq_unquiesce_tagset);
